Main Shop Service Advisor J.C. Lewis Motor Company 📍 Hinesville , GA Drive Your Career Forward with Georgia s Oldest & Most Trusted Dealership J.C. Lewis Motor Co. is proud to be Georgia s oldest continually owned and operated automobile dealership, serving Savannah and the surrounding communities since 1912. At our Hinesville location, we're looking for a Main Shop Service Advisor to join our team and serve as the primary point of contact for our service customers. In this customer-facing role, you will own the service experience from start to finish. From greeting customers in the drive lane to coordinating service and explaining recommendations, you will ensure each customer feels informed, respected, and confident in the care of their vehicle. This is a fast-paced, team-oriented position ideal for individuals who enjoy helping others, staying organized, and keeping things moving. We welcome candidates with backgrounds in customer service, retail, hospitality, or the restaurant industry who are ready to learn and grow. What You ll
Do:
Serve as the first point of contact for customers in the service drive Coordinate and manage service appointments, walk-ins, and workflow to ensure efficient operations Communicate clearly with customers regarding vehicle status, recommended services, timelines, and next steps Write repair orders and explain the service process in a professional, customer-friendly manner Manage and distribute technician work efficiently to support productivity and timely service Take ownership of the customer experience by providing accurate, timely, and courteous support Work closely with technicians and service leadership to deliver consistent, high-quality results What We re
Looking For:
Vehicle/vehicle repair knowledge and experience preferred Friendly, professional, and customer-focused demeanor Strong verbal and written communication skills 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ment Solid time management and organizational skills Professional appearance and demeanor in accordance with dealership standards Valid driver's license and acceptable driving record Willingness to submit to a pre-employment background check Must be at least 19 years of age
